MDC: Zim crisis critical

2008-11-25 17:11

Johannesburg - Zimbabwe's humanitarian crisis has reached a "critical level" with cholera killing hundreds across the country, the opposition said on Tuesday ahead of political talks in South Africa.

Negotiators for President Robert Mugabe's Zanu-PF party and the opposition Movement for Democratic Change (MDC) are due to meet on Tuesday in South Africa in a bid to revive a stalled unity accord signed two months ago.

"The situation on the ground in the country has reached a critical level (meaning) that an agreement has to be reached," MDC spokesperson Nelson Chamisa said.

But he warned: "It's difficult to be hopeful when you are dealing with an insincere, deceitful and dishonest party like Zanu-PF.

"There are also challenges around the issue of facilitation" by former South African president and formal mediator Thabo Mbeki, Chamisa said without giving details.

Mbeki brokered the accord signed on September 15, calling for Mugabe to remain as president while MDC leader Morgan Tsvangirai takes the new post of prime minister.

Tsvangirai won a first-round presidential election in March, but pulled out of the run-off accusing Mugabe's party of orchestrating deadly attacks against his supporters.

The unity accord was meant to end the political crisis, but the deal has stalled over disputes about how to divide control of key cabinet posts and which powers to grant the new premier.

MDC's chief negotiator Tendai Biti said that he had arrived in South Africa for the talks, but was still waiting to find out where the negotiations would take place.

"I have no idea" where the venue will be, he said.

The political vacuum has exacerbated Zimbabwe's mounting humanitarian crisis, the cholera epidemic killing nearly 300 people across the country and spilling across the border into South Africa.

Nearly half the population is expected to need emergency food aid in January, while the economy has been shattered by the world's highest rate of inflation, last estimated at 231 million percent in July.

South African President Kgalema Motlanthe warned on Monday that unless a political deal is reached, "the situation will get worse and will implode or collapse altogether".

Zimbabwe's powerful southern neighbour has taken a tougher line on the spiralling crisis, freezing $30m in farm aid until a unity government is installed.

Mugabe's regime has shown no sign of relenting, and on Tuesday accused former US president Jimmy Carter and ex-UN chief Kofi Annan of plotting to overthrow the government, after rejecting their humanitarian mission to the country.

- AFP
